INDEPENDENT TESTING ALL TEST RESULTS WERE EVALUATED BY INDEPENDENT LABORATORIES - HAYES MICROBIAL CONSULTING, UNIVERSITY OF WISCONSIN DEPARTMENT OF BIOLOGY, EMSL ANALYTICAL, INC. LOCATIONS SAMPLES WERE OBTAINED FROM AIRPLANES, MEDICAL, COMMERCIAL AND RESIDENTIAL ENVIRONMENTS. STRAINS OF BACTERIA AND FUNGI STRAINS OF BACTERIA IDENTIFIED INCLUDED STAPHYLOCOCCUS, PSEUDOMONAS, MICROCOCCUS, ASPERGILLUS, FERMENTER AND NON-FERMENTER GRAM NEGATIVE BACTERIA. FUNGI, INCLUDING MOLD AND YEAST INCLUDED CLADOSPORIUM, AUREOBASIDIUM AND RHODOTORULA.

TWO ROOMS OF A RESIDENTIAL HOME WERE TESTED - FAMILY ROOM AND BEDROOM. TOTAL OF 4 TYPES OF ALLERGENS WERE FOUND IN THE SAMPLES .
THE SAMPLES WERE COLLECTED FROM THE FLOOR
BETTERAIR TESTINGIN HOMES
TYPES OF IRRITANTS FOUND IN SAMPLES A1 - DUST MITE ALLERGEN TYPE 1 A2 - DUST MITE ALLERGEN TYPE 2 A3 - CAT ALLERGEN A4 - COCKROACH ALLERGEN
AFTER 1 MONTH OF USE, DUST MITE ALLERGENS TYPE 2, PET AND COCKROACH ALLERGENS HAD DIMINISHED.
TYPE A1 ALLERGENS IN FAMILY ROOM WERE REDUCED BY 95%.
PROBIOTIC BACTERIA SIGNIFICANTLY REDUCED OR COMPLETELY DIMINISHED ORGANIC IRRITANTS THAT
ARE THE MAIN CAUSE FOR ALLERGIES AT HOMES.
INDEPENDENT TESTING - SAMPLES WERE TESTED BY EMSL ANALTICAL, INC
